§ 30-22-6 — Powers and duties of the board

(a)The board has all the powers and duties set forth in this article, by rule, in article one of this chapter, and elsewhere in law.
(b)The board's powers and duties include:
(1)Holding meetings, conducting hearings and administering examinations and reexaminations;
(2)Setting the requirements for a license, temporary permit and certificate of authorization;
(3)Establishing procedures for submitting, approving and rejecting applications for a license, temporary permit and certificate of authorization;
(4)Determining the qualifications of any applicant for a license, temporary permit and certificate of authorization;
(5)Preparing, conducting, administering and grading written, oral or written and oral examinations and reexaminations for a license;
